- The distance between Morada Nova, Brazil and Mahinerangi Dam, New Zealand is approximately 13,694 km or 8,509 mi.
- To reach Morada Nova in this distance one would set out from Mahinerangi Dam bearing 145.6°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Morada Nova bearing 23.3° or NNE .
- Morada Nova has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Mahinerangi Dam has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Morada Nova is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Mahinerangi Dam is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 18.5 °C (33.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.1 °C (12.8°F) less in Morada Nova.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 98.8 mm (3.9 in) less which is equivalent to 98.8 l/m² (2.42 US gal/ft²) or 988,000 l/ha (105,624 US gal/ac) less. About 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 30.6° higher in Morada Nova than in Mahinerangi Dam.
